SWA awards do not have any blackout dates or capacity control parameters at all.
For the other airlines, it will be difficult to use miles for an award at that time. If you can do so, you will probably have to use twice the normal miles in order to avoid the restrictions.
They do have a few blackout dates in December - according to Randy's chart these are December 22, 23, 26, 29 and 30, but other than that as you said there are zero capacity controls which I really appreciate (I don't think any other airline would have let me fly to Florida in December using a "saver" award), and in the past I have found the blackout dates fairly easy to work around.
